Product Description:
The MSM115-89-404-M-0KA is a brushless servo motor produced by Kollmorgen for the MSM Brushless Servo Motors series. Designed for closed-loop motion axes in packaging machines, pick-and-place gantries, and general automation, the unit converts drive current into precise rotary motion that can be programmed for position, velocity, or torque control. Its electromagnetic design allows tight regulation of shaft dynamics, letting equipment manufacturers synchronize multiple axes without mechanical gearing. The motor works with Kollmorgen AKD and similar servo drives, supplying the mechanical output layer of a digitally commanded system.
The motor delivers a continuous shaft torque of 10 Nm while remaining within its rated temperature limits. When short bursts of acceleration are required, the available peak torque rises to 32 Nm and can be reached with the drive’s peak phase current of 38.2 A. Nominal operation occurs at 4000 rpm, a speed supported by a six-pole rotor that balances resolution and mechanical stress. The torque constant of 1.03 Nm/A links commanded current to developed torque, while the back-EMF constant of 123 V/KRPM helps determine the appropriate drive voltage. Electrical response is influenced by a phase inductance of 12.0 mH and resistance of 2.0 Ω measured at 25 °C, while inertial loading is moderated by the 0.0016 kg·m² rotor. Startup current is limited to a stall value of 10.9 A, protecting the winding during locked-rotor conditions.
The distance from the front face to the shaft end is 317 mm, and the overall housing length is 357 mm, allowing the motor to fit medium-frame machines without overhanging bearings. A mass of 11.0 kg provides thermal capacity for continuous duty while keeping the motor manageable during installation. Power is transmitted through a shaft with an ISO metric thread of M6 × 1.0, and coupling hardware can seat to a depth of 16 mm to secure pulleys or couplings without additional spacers.
